实验吧逆向工程-Byte Code

题目下载链接:http://ctf5.shiyanbar.com/reverse/byte-code/tmp.zip
新的一题,最近也是很烦躁啊,论文写不出来。学习知识放松一下吧。
题目中又有一段英文提示:
你需要与警卫进行身份验证才能进入装货区! 从Vault应用程序输入root密码以检索密钥! 此类文件是Vault应用程序的可执行文件。
大概意思就是需要输入密码才能获取进入权限吧,让我看看到底是个什么东西。
1、解压过后是一个.class文件,.class文件我以为应该是一个java文件,但是使用Notepad打开是乱码,然后发现:
.class文件是.java文件编译后生成的字节码文件,我们使用一般的文本编辑工具打开的话,里面的内容是乱码。
参考百度经验:https://jingyan.baidu.com/article/d169e18677e87b436611d81f.html
2、经介绍是使用java反编译软件JD-GUI,下载地址为:http://java-decompiler.github.io/


3、打开之后代码清晰可见:

4、看代码逻辑就可以获得Key,就顺序赋值一个字符串,注意大小写,k是小写。

小结:今天的题目还是挺简单的,学到了一个新的java反编译工具。

你可能感兴趣的:(实验吧逆向工程-Byte Code)